RESPONSIBILITIES:
Student Evaluation and Services
- Support the Student Services Team in conducting diagnostic assessments such as
- Functional Behavior Assessments (FBA) and Behavior Intervention Plans (BIP) to identify scholars' needs and make referrals as appropriate.
- Provide mandated counseling services, facilitate social skills-building groups, and implement curricula to address student needs and reduce barriers to learning.
- Collaborate with school and network team members to determine the services needed for each student, based on their IEP goals and requirements, their personal goals, and
- Maintain secure, up-to-date confidential files on every scholar on your caseload.
- Complete confidential written notes of all cases and sessions.
- Complete Related Service Provider reports for IEP meetings, add counseling updates to the Social Development section of the IEP, create counseling goals, monitor state, local agencies, laws, and regulations.
- Maintain client confidentiality.
